ISRO Scientist/Engineer 'SC' Recruitment 2026

Organization: Indian Space Research Organisation (ISRO)
Advt No: ISRO/HQ/REC/SC-ENG/05/2026

Quick Summary: ISRO invites online applications from dynamic and eligible candidates for the recruitment of Scientist/Engineer 'SC' in various disciplines like Electronics, Mechanical, Computer Science, Civil, and Electrical Engineering. ๐ŸŽ“ Eligibility & Qualifications

Minimum Qualification Required: Graduate

B.E./B.Tech or equivalent degree in relevant discipline (Electronics, Mechanical, Computer Science, Civil, Electrical, etc.) with a minimum of 65% aggregate marks or CGPA 6.84/10 from a recognized University/Institution.

Age Limits: 18 to 35 years.

โšก Selection Process

1Written Examination
2Interview

โ“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What are the age relaxations?

Age relaxation is applicable as per Government of India rules for SC/ST (5 years), OBC (3 years), PwBD, Ex-Servicemen, and other eligible categories.

Can final year students apply?

No, candidates must possess the essential qualification, i.e., their B.E./B.Tech degree, on or before the closing date of application.

Is there negative marking in the written exam?

Yes, there will be negative marking for incorrect answers in the written examination, usually 1/3rd of the marks allotted for each question.
